New Delhi: With 2,38,018 fresh infections, India’s Coronavirus caseload rose to 3,76,18,271 today, including 8,891 Omicron variant cases.
According to Union Health Ministry data updated this morning, the country’s Covid-19 death toll climbed to 4,86,761 with 310 new fatalities. The active Covid-19 cases have increased to 17,36,628, the highest in 230 days.
India’s Covid-19 tally had crossed the 20-lakh mark on 7 August, 2020, 30 lakh on 23 August, 40 lakh on 5 September and 50 lakh on 16 September. It went past 60 lakh on 28 September, 70 lakh on 11 October, crossed 80 lakh on 29 October, 90 lakh on 20 November and surpassed the one-crore mark on 19 December. India crossed the grim milestone of two crore on 4 May and three crore on 23 June.
